Assess Your Appliances and Their Needs
Before diving into the cleaning process, it’s important to assess each appliance and its unique needs. Different appliance types, like ovens, refrigerators, and microwaves, each require specific attention. A refrigerator might gather crumbs and spills, while an oven can collect grease and grime.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right cleaning products for each task.
Start by inspecting your appliances for any visible dirt, stains, or build-up. Make a note of their materials, as some might need gentle cleaners, while others can handle tougher scrubs. For example, glass surfaces love a streak-free cleaner, while stainless steel shines best with a special solution.

Create a Weekly and Monthly Cleaning Plan
Creating a cleaning plan can feel like a giant task, yet it can also be a fantastic way to keep appliances shiny and fresh. By setting up simple weekly checklists, anyone can tackle minor cleanings while it’s easy. Focus on wiping down surfaces, checking filters, and maintaining regular tasks like cleaning out the fridge. This helps prevent bigger messes down the road!
Moreover, integrating monthly deep cleaning sessions can make a world of difference. For instance, deep cleaning the oven or dishwasher eliminates stubborn grime. During these sessions, take the time to really get into those nooks and crannies.

How Often Should I Clean My Washing Machine?
The washing machine should be cleaned at least once a month for ideal maintenance. Drum cleaning helps prevent odors and buildup, ensuring the appliance operates efficiently and prolonging its life. Regular attention is essential for performance.

Are There Eco-Friendly Cleaning Products I Can Use?
Yes, eco-friendly alternatives exist. Many can be crafted using natural ingredients such as vinegar, baking soda, and essential oils, providing effective cleaning without harmful chemicals, making them a safe choice for both health and the environment.
Can I Clean Appliances While They Are Still Plugged In?
It is not safe to clean appliances while they are still plugged in. Proper safety precautions should always be observed, including unplugging devices. Various cleaning methods can be effectively employed once power is disconnected.
What Are the Signs That an Appliance Needs Extra Cleaning?
When does an appliance signal it requires more attention? Signs include a persistent appliance odor, an unusual noise during operation, or visible grime build-up, indicating the need for a thorough cleaning to maintain efficiency and longevity.
